1. Register on the SC2ReplayStats website. 2. Download either the standalone program or SC2Gears plugin. 3. Activate the above by inputting a unique hashkey that identifies them with their account on the website. Haskey found under Settings when you are logged in on the website. 4. Enable the plugin/program. 5. Create a 1v1 game versus another human on the appropriate maps and play as normal. 6. After the game ends, the replay will automatically be sent to the website database, and it will do all of the calculations for you. 7. Check the website for details, ranks, and other match statistics. - It will still work if you upload a new version or new maps. It is map or version independent. It would be nice for Breath to have some heads up, though. - If players do not wish to be ranked, they can just play without the plugin/program enabled. I have also uploaded separate maps so this is even easier. For example, [R] are ranked maps, but you still have to have the tool enabled. The other maps will never count as ranked. - Personally, I think bank files are easy to exploit, even though I hope no one would >_<. By having the statistics stored on an external server, more ways to combat cheating are available to us. Breath already has some security for this system and will continue to improve it. On top of that, we have all of the replays stored and whatnot, so it is available for us to examine if there is any weird stuff going on. - If people want to find people of similar skill, they can either just do what FISH people do and say it in chat "1436+++" or whatever. Or they can just go to the website and check who is close to them in rating and then give them a message in game. Kind of clunky, but it is definitely a start. - Right now, my mod is only on NA, but I plan on expanding it as soon as I work out a few things. The way the ranking system works right now, I believe it is a global ranking, despite people being separated by server region. Maybe later this can be changed as Breath improves its functionality, but with Global Play, I do not think this should be too much of an issue. - If the game is less than 1 minute, it will not count as ranked. There are a lot of good things about using Bank files, however. It is seamless, as there is nothing to download. Furthermore, you can just make it so that you can check stuff in-game. It really is up to you and what the community wants. ![]() | ||

Since players are not automatically matched, security is less of an issue. If a player plays against another player that cheated with the ranking file, he will find out. The result: 1. He will most likely not play against the cheating player anymore. 2. It will be known in the chat and the cheating player can no longer play anyone. or he does not find out and: 1. The person in question is quickly defeated, unless he was actually good, and it all doesn't matter in the end. 2. Nobody cares, nobody knows since ranking files are personal. Because of this, its not that much of a big deal if someone cheats with the ranking file. It will flush itself out. I still want to stress that you have to go to quite some lengths to cheat with this system, and the most likely scenario is that very few will even attempt to cheat the ranking file for a mod. | ||
